+require "rsync_command/version"
+require "rsync_command/ssh_options"
+require "rsync_command/thread_pool"
+
+require 'monitor'
+
+class RsyncCommand
+ attr_accessor :failures, :logger
+
+ def initialize(options={})
+ @options = options.dup
+ @logger = @options.delete(:logger)
+ @flags = @options.delete(:flags)
+ @failures = []
+ @failures.extend(MonitorMixin)
+ end
+
+ #
+ # takes an Enumerable and iterates each item in the list in parallel.
+ #
+ def asynchronously(array, &block)
+ pool = ThreadPool.new
+ array.each do |item|
+ pool.schedule(item, &block)
+ end
+ pool.shutdown
+ end
+
+ #
+ # runs rsync, recording failures
+ #
+ def exec(src, dest, options={})
+ @failures.synchronize do
+ @failures.clear
+ end
+ rsync_cmd = command(src, dest, options)
+ if options[:chdir]
+ rsync_cmd = "cd '#{options[:chdir]}'; #{rsync_cmd}"
+ end
+ @logger.debug rsync_cmd if @logger
+ ok = system(rsync_cmd)
+ unless ok
+ @failures.synchronize do
+ @failures << {:source => src, :dest => dest, :options => options.dup}
+ end
+ end
+ end
+
+ #
+ # returns true if last exec returned a failure
+ #
+ def failed?
+ @failures && @failures.any?
+ end
+
+ #
+ # build rsync command
+ #
+ def command(src, dest, options={})
+ src = remote_address(src)
+ dest = remote_address(dest)
+ options = @options.merge(options)
+ flags = []
+ flags << @flags if @flags
+ flags << options[:flags] if options.has_key?(:flags)
+ flags << '--delete' if options[:delete]
+ flags << includes(options[:includes]) if options.has_key?(:includes)
+ flags << excludes(options[:excludes]) if options.has_key?(:excludes)
+ flags << SshOptions.new(options[:ssh]).to_flags if options.has_key?(:ssh)
+ "rsync #{flags.compact.join(' ')} #{src} #{dest}"
+ end
+
+ private
+
+ #
+ # Creates an rsync location if the +address+ is a hash with keys :user, :host, and :path
+ # (each component is optional). If +address+ is a string, we just pass it through.
+ #
+ def remote_address(address)
+ if address.is_a? String
+ address # assume it is already formatted.
+ elsif address.is_a? Hash
+ [[address[:user], address[:host]].compact.join('@'), address[:path]].compact.join(':')
+ end
+ end
+
+ def excludes(patterns)
+ [patterns].flatten.compact.map { |p| "--exclude='#{p}'" }
+ end
+
+ def includes(patterns)
+ [patterns].flatten.compact.map { |p| "--include='#{p}'" }
+ end
+
+end

+#
+# Converts capistrano-style ssh configuration (which uses Net::SSH) into a OpenSSH command line flags suitable for rsync.
+#
+# For a list of the options normally support by Net::SSH (and thus Capistrano), see
+# http://net-ssh.github.com/net-ssh/classes/Net/SSH.html#method-c-start
+#
+# Also, to see how Net::SSH does the opposite of the conversion we are doing here, check out:
+# https://github.com/net-ssh/net-ssh/blob/master/lib/net/ssh/config.rb
+#
+# API mismatch:
+#
+# * many OpenSSH options not supported
+# * some options only make sense for Net::SSH
+# * compression: for Net::SSH, this option is supposed to accept true, false, or algorithm. OpenSSH accepts 'yes' or 'no'
+#
+class RsyncCommand
+ class SshOptions
+
+ def initialize(options={})
+ @options = parse_options(options)
+ end
+
+ def to_flags
+ if @options.empty?
+ nil
+ else
+ %[-e "ssh #{@options.join(' ')}"]
+ end
+ end
+
+ private
+
+ def parse_options(options)
+ options.map do |key, value|
+ next unless value
+ # Convert Net::SSH options into OpenSSH options.
+ case key
+ when :auth_methods then opt_auth_methods(value)
+ when :bind_address then opt('BindAddress', value)
+ when :compression then opt('Compression', value ? 'yes' : 'no')
+ when :compression_level then opt('CompressionLevel', value.to_i)
+ when :config then "-F '#{value}'"
+ when :encryption then opt('Ciphers', [value].flatten.join(','))
+ when :forward_agent then opt('ForwardAgent', value)
+ when :global_known_hosts_file then opt('GlobalKnownHostsFile', value)
+ when :hmac then opt('MACs', [value].flatten.join(','))
+ when :host_key then opt('HostKeyAlgorithms', [value].flatten.join(','))
+ when :host_key_alias then opt('HostKeyAlias', value)
+ when :host_name then opt('HostName', value)
+ when :kex then opt('KexAlgorithms', [value].flatten.join(','))
+ when :key_data then nil # not supported
+ when :keys then [value].flatten.select { |k| File.exist?(k) }.map { |k| "-i '#{k}'" }
+ when :keys_only then opt('IdentitiesOnly', value ? 'yes' : 'no')
+ when :languages then nil # not applicable
+ when :logger then nil # not applicable
+ when :paranoid then opt('StrictHostKeyChecking', value ? 'yes' : 'no')
+ when :passphrase then nil # not supported
+ when :password then nil # not supported
+ when :port then "-p #{value.to_i}"
+ when :properties then nil # not applicable
+ when :proxy then nil # not applicable
+ when :rekey_blocks_limit then nil # not supported
+ when :rekey_limit then opt('RekeyLimit', reverse_interpret_size(value))
+ when :rekey_packet_limit then nil # not supported
+ when :timeout then opt('ConnectTimeout', value.to_i)
+ when :user then "-l #{value}"
+ when :user_known_hosts_file then multi_opt('UserKnownHostsFile', value)
+ when :verbose then opt('LogLevel', interpret_log_level(value))
+ end
+ end.compact
+ end
+
+ private
+
+ def opt(option_name, option_value)
+ "-o #{option_name}='#{option_value}'"
+ end
+
+ def multi_opt(option_name, option_values)
+ [option_values].flatten.map do |value|
+ opt(option_name, value)
+ end.join(' ')
+ end
+
+ #
+ # In OpenSSH, password and pubkey default to 'yes', hostbased defaults to 'no'.
+ # Regardless, if :auth_method is configured, then we explicitly set the auth method.
+ #
+ def opt_auth_methods(value)
+ value = [value].flatten
+ opts = []
+ if value.any?
+ if value.include? 'password'
+ opts << opt('PasswordAuthentication', 'yes')
+ else
+ opts << opt('PasswordAuthentication', 'no')
+ end
+ if value.include? 'publickey'
+ opts << opt('PubkeyAuthentication', 'yes')
+ else
+ opts << opt('PubkeyAuthentication', 'no')
+ end
+ if value.include? 'hostbased'
+ opts << opt('HostbasedAuthentication', 'yes')
+ else
+ opts << opt('HostbasedAuthentication', 'no')
+ end
+ end
+ if opts.any?
+ return opts.join(' ')
+ else
+ nil
+ end
+ end
+
+ #
+ # Converts the given integer size in bytes into a string with 'K', 'M', 'G' suffix, as appropriate.
+ #
+ # reverse of interpret_size in https://github.com/net-ssh/net-ssh/blob/master/lib/net/ssh/config.rb
+ #
+ def reverse_interpret_size(size)
+ size = size.to_i
+ if size < 1024
+ "#{size}"
+ elsif size < 1024 * 1024
+ "#{size/1024}K"
+ elsif size < 1024 * 1024 * 1024
+ "#{size/(1024*1024)}M"
+ else
+ "#{size/(1024*1024*1024)}G"
+ end
+ end
+
+ def interpret_log_level(level)
+ if level.is_a? Symbol
+ case level
+ when :debug then "DEBUG"
+ when :info then "INFO"
+ when :warn then "ERROR"
+ when :error then "ERROR"
+ when :fatal then "FATAL"
+ else "INFO"
+ end
+ elsif level.is_a?(Integer) && defined?(Logger)
+ case level
+ when Logger::DEBUG then "DEBUG"
+ when Logger::INFO then "INFO"
+ when Logger::WARN then "ERROR"
+ when Logger::ERROR then "ERROR"
+ when Logger::FATAL then "FATAL"
+ else "INFO"
+ end
+ else
+ "INFO"
+ end
+ end
+
+ end
+end

+require 'thread'
+
+class RsyncCommand
+ class ThreadPool
+ class << self
+ attr_accessor :default_size
+ end
+
+ def initialize(size=nil)
+ @size = size || ThreadPool.default_size || 10
+ @jobs = Queue.new
+ @retvals = []
+ @pool = Array.new(@size) do |i|
+ Thread.new do
+ Thread.current[:id] = i
+ catch(:exit) do
+ loop do
+ job, args = @jobs.pop
+ @retvals << job.call(*args)
+ end
+ end
+ end
+ end
+ end
+ def schedule(*args, &block)
+ @jobs << [block, args]
+ end
+ def shutdown
+ @size.times do
+ schedule { throw :exit }
+ end
+ @pool.map(&:join)
+ @retvals
+ end
+ end
+end
